The video explores the rise of the Mongol Empire under Genghis Khan and its expansion into Europe and the Middle East. It highlights the formation of the Mamluk Sultanate and its resistance against the Mongol threat. The Mongols' capture of Baghdad in 1258 marked a significant event, leading to the destruction of the Abbasid Caliphate. The video culminates in the Battle of Ayn Jalut, where the Mamluks, led by Sultan Catoos and By Bars, achieved a decisive victory against the Mongols, halting their westward expansion and preserving Islamic civilization.
